We are using Outlook 2003 with the internet mail options -
no Exchange server. I have a need to retrieve e-mail from
3 different e-mail accounts. I have had the first account
set up through the "Account" option in Outlook and all is
well. I now would like to add the other two accounts.
What is the best way to do this? From the Add Account or
by adding profiles. When responding to messages received
on each account I would like for the appropriate e-mail
address to appear in the from: field. I am not sure of
the difference between setting up through Account and
Profiles.

You can have multiple e-mail accounts set up in a single profile. When
composing a new message, Outlook will use the account set as the default.
When replying to messages, it will use the account to which the message was
originally sent.

Tools | E-Mail Accounts is the place to start adding new accounts.

Note - there is still a limitation of running only a single Hotmail account
in a profile, however.
